Brief Overview of the Company Frost & Sullivan, founded in 1961, has 26 global offices with more than 1500 industry consultants, market research analysts, technology analysts and economists. Our mission is to research and analyze new market opportunities for corporate growth. They are the world leaders in growth consulting and the integrated areas of technology research, market research, economic research, corporate best practices, training, customer research, competitive intelligence and corporate strategy. Frost & Sullivan was the first company to offer its services on electronic tape media, delivering world military equipment market data in 1962. Frost & Sullivan is a consulting company. The company integrates growth consulting, partnership services and training in corporate management. Its services are designed to identify and develop opportunities with regard to business growth. The company serves a clientele that includes large corporations, emerging companies and the investment community. It provides industry coverage that reflects a global perspective and relies upon ongoing analysis of markets, technologies, econometrics and demographics.

Services Offered Growth Partnership Services The focus of the Growth Partnership Service is to drive the client's business growth by providing them with a continuous flow of strategic information and ideas covering their market sector.

Growth Consulting Frost & Sullivan's Growth Consulting services encompass customized research, business strategy, and organizational development initiatives. They provide uniquely powerful, innovative, and practical solutions to help companies successfully address their growth challenges. These services are tailor-made on a case-by-case basis, leveraging its unique combination of market expertise, global presence, and relationships with key industry players.

Corporate Training and Development Frost & Sullivan's mission is to enable world-class companies to increase productivity and performance through their people. Their In-Company training solution is all about the client's organisation - they work with their clientele to identify their individual and company-wide training needs to deliver a course that meets their needs.

Research Groups Frost & Sullivan's research groups provide clients with the information they need to ensure their future plans are based on solid, reliable facts and analysis. Frost & Sullivan research services include market analysis, technical research services, end-user studies, and more quantitative measurement based services.
